Thx for help       </description><language>en-US</language><copyright>(C) Copyright 2006-2026 Inflectra Corporation.</copyright><managingEditor>support@inflectra.com</managingEditor><category domain="http://www.dmoz.org">/Computers/Software/Project_Management/</category><category domain="http://www.dmoz.org">/Computers/Software/Quality_Assurance/</category><generator>KronoDesk</generator><a10:contributor><a10:email>support@inflectra.com</a10:email></a10:contributor><a10:id>http://www.inflectra.com/kronodesk/forums/threads</a10:id><ttl>120</ttl><link>/Support/Forum/spirateam/issues-questions/249.aspx</link><item><guid isPermaLink="false">threadId=249</guid><author>Sandro Bischof (sandro.bischof@frama.com)</author><title>Timeouts on webpage and error message in application Log</title><description>  Hi all  We are using Spirateam V 3.2 hosted on a Windows Server 2003 with IIS  6.0  Some users have sometimes problems to work with spirateam. When they try to connect to the webpage or to work in spirateam they get timeouts... (Firefox and IE)  On the webserver in the Application Event Log we have several errors:  ------ Source: SpiraTeam / Category: None / EventID:0  APPLICATION.Business.Release::Update: The version number specified is not unique  For more information, see Help and Support Center at http://go.microsoft.com/fwlink/events.asp.   ------ Source: SpiraTeam / Category: None / EventID:0  APPLICATION.Business.User::UpdateLastOpenedProject: Database foreign key violation occurred [APPLICATION.Business.DataAccessForeignKeyException] The UPDATE statement conflicted with the FOREIGN KEY constraint "FK_PROJECT_USER". The conflict occurred in database "SpiraTeam", table "dbo.TST_PROJECT", column 'PROJECT_ID'. The statement has been terminated. [System.Data.SqlClient.SqlException]  Stack Trace:    at APPLICATION.Business.DataAccess.ExecuteNonQuery(String sqlCommand, Boolean useParam)    at APPLICATION.Business.UserManager.UpdateLastOpenedProject(Int32 userId, Int32 lastOpenedProjectId)  I have no idea if the errors have something to do with the timeouts or not...  Thx for help       </description><pubDate>Wed, 29 Feb 2012 14:13:43 -0500</pubDate><a10:updated>2012-02-29T14:47:37-05:00</a10:updated><link>/Support/Forum/spirateam/issues-questions/249.aspx</link></item><item><guid isPermaLink="false">messageId=482</guid><author>David J (adam.sandman+support@inflectra.com)</author><title> Please could you make sure that you're on the latest patch for v3.2 (currently patch 009) that shou</title><description> Please could you make sure that you're on the latest patch for v3.2 (currently patch 009) that should fix the error messages you're seeing. If not, please send a ticket to  support@inflectra.com  so that we can investigate further for you.    Regarding the timeouts, please refresh the database indexes and that should address the issue (see  https://www.inflectra.com/Support/FAQs.aspx?productId=3#technical07 ). </description><pubDate>Wed, 29 Feb 2012 14:47:37 -0500</pubDate><a10:updated>2012-02-29T14:47:37-05:00</a10:updated><link>/Support/Forum/spirateam/issues-questions/249.aspx#reply482</link></item></channel></rss>
